Understand Different Types of Car Insurance

In Australia, car insurance typically falls into three main categories:

  • Compulsory Third Party (CTP) Insurance: This insurance is mandatory in all states and territories. It covers personal injury liability but does not cover damage to your vehicle or others’ property.
  • Third Party Property Damage Insurance: This type of insurance covers damage you may cause to another person's vehicle or property, providing a broader form of protection than CTP.
  • Comprehensive Insurance: This policy covers damage to your vehicle, damage to other vehicles, theft, and even damages resulting from natural disasters. It offers the most extensive protection.

Gather Multiple Quotes

To effectively compare car insurance near you, gather quotes from several reputable insurers. You can do this either online or by calling insurance representatives directly. When requesting quotes, provide the same information to each insurer to ensure accurate comparisons.

Also consider using insurance comparison websites. These platforms allow you to enter your details once and receive quotes from multiple providers, streamlining the process significantly.

Consider Discounts

Many insurers offer discounts that might apply to you. These can include:

  • Multi-policy discounts for bundling car insurance with home or health insurance
  • No-claims discounts for maintaining a clean driving record
  • Safe driver discounts for those with advanced driving qualifications

Be sure to inquire about these discounts when getting quotes—it can significantly reduce your overall premium.
